  • HP's Tablet Strategy: Can Hewlett-Packard Compete in the Growing Tablet Market?
    Can Hewlett-Packard survive the tablet trend?

    In recent years, the tablet market has grown exponentially, with Apple's iPad leading the way. This has put pressure on traditional PC makers like Hewlett-Packard (HP) to adapt and compete in this new market. Can HP survive the tablet trend?

    HP's challenges

    HP faces a number of challenges in the tablet market. First, the company is a late entrant to the market, and Apple has a significant head start. Apple has built a strong brand and ecosystem around the iPad, making it difficult for competitors to gain market share.

    Second, HP's tablets are more expensive than many of its competitors'. This is due in part to the fact that HP uses higher-quality materials and components in its tablets. However, this pricing strategy makes it difficult for HP to compete with lower-priced tablets from Amazon, Google, and Samsung.

    Third, HP's tablets have not been as well-received by critics as some of its competitors' tablets. Some reviewers have criticized HP's tablets for their lack of innovation, their heavy weight, and their poor battery life.

    HP's strengths

    Despite these challenges, HP does have some strengths that could help it to succeed in the tablet market. First, HP is a well-known brand with a strong reputation for quality. This could give HP an advantage over some of its less-established competitors.

    Second, HP has a wide distribution network. This could help HP to get its tablets into the hands of consumers more quickly and easily than some of its competitors.

    Third, HP has a strong track record of innovation. This could help HP to develop new and innovative tablets that could appeal to consumers.
